Brant: A Comprehensive Overview of a Resilient Waterfowl

Brant, also known as Branta bernicla, is a small, dark goose that is a member of the waterfowl family Anatidae. Known for its distinctive appearance and migratory prowess, the Brant has become a subject of interest for ornithologists and bird enthusiasts worldwide. Physical Characteristics

Brant are typically characterized by their compact size, with a body length ranging from 55 to 66 centimeters and a wingspan of about 110 to 120 centimeters. They possess a predominantly black head, neck, and chest, with a contrasting white patch on the sides of their necks, which is a hallmark of the species. The rest of their plumage is primarily dark gray-brown, interspersed with lighter fringes on the feathers, providing effective camouflage against their natural environment.

Habitat and Distribution

Brant are primarily found in coastal regions, with a breeding range that spans the high Arctic tundra of North America, Europe, and Asia. During the non-breeding season, they migrate to milder coastal areas, including parts of the United States, Western Europe, and East Asia. Their preference for coastal habitats is largely due to their reliance on specific food sources, such as eelgrass and sea lettuce, which are abundant in these regions.

The migratory patterns of Brant are remarkable, with some populations traveling over 3,000 miles between their breeding and wintering grounds. These epic journeys highlight the species’ resilience and adaptability, as they navigate various ecological zones and face numerous environmental challenges along the way.

Diet and Feeding Habits

The diet of Brant is primarily herbivorous, consisting mainly of marine vegetation such as eelgrass (Zostera marina) and sea lettuce (Ulva spp.). During the breeding season, their diet may diversify to include terrestrial plants and invertebrates, providing essential nutrients for the energy-intensive process of raising their young.

Brant are known for their foraging efficiency, often feeding in large flocks to maximize food intake while minimizing the risk of predation. This social feeding behavior is a key survival strategy, allowing them to exploit food resources effectively and maintain their energy reserves during long migratory flights.

Conservation Status and Efforts

The Brant population is currently considered stable, with an estimated global population of around 500,000 individuals. However, they face several threats, including habitat loss due to coastal development, climate change, and disturbances from human activities.

Conservation efforts for Brant focus on habitat protection and management, particularly in key breeding and wintering areas. Initiatives such as the establishment of protected areas, restoration of coastal habitats, and international cooperation on migratory bird conservation are crucial for ensuring the long-term survival of the species.

Organizations such as the International Union for Conservation of Nature (IUCN) and various national wildlife agencies are actively involved in monitoring Brant populations and implementing conservation strategies. Public awareness campaigns and community engagement are also essential components of conservation efforts, fostering a sense of stewardship among local communities and encouraging sustainable practices.
